PARTS MANAGER
Job Summary
We are seeking an experienced and results-driven Parts Manager to oversee the daily operations of our truck dealership parts department. This role is responsible for inventory control, vendor relations, team leadership, and ensuring timely availability of parts to support service technicians and customers. The ideal candidate will have strong leadership skills, a solid understanding of heavy-duty truck parts, and a customer-focused mindset.
Key Responsibilities
Manage daily operations of the parts department
Supervise, train, and schedule parts department staff
Maintain accurate inventory levels and conduct regular cycle counts
Order parts and manage vendor relationships to ensure competitive pricing and availability
Coordinate with the service department to support repair timelines
Monitor department performance, sales, and profitability
Ensure proper handling of warranty parts and returns
Maintain a clean, organized, and safe parts department
Ensure compliance with company policies and procedures
Requirements
Qualifications
Previous experience as a Parts Manager or Parts Supervisor (truck or diesel dealership preferred)
Strong knowledge of heavy-duty truck parts and inventory systems
Leadership and team management experience
Strong organizational and problem-solving skills
Excellent communication and customer service skills
Proficiency in dealership software and inventory management systems
Valid driver’s license required
